Is Oconee County a good place to live?
Oconee County was recently ranked #1 on the 2020 “Best Counties for Families in America” list by Niche. Oconee also earned the #2 spot in the “Best Counties to Live” category and the #3 rank in both the “Best Public Schools” and “Best Counties to Buy a House” categories, with an overall grade of A+.

Is Oconee GA Safe?
Oconee County is as safe versus other counties of the same size for crime. The table below compares crime in counties with comparable overall population in the county’s boundaries. Considering only the crime rate, Oconee County is safer than the Georgia state average and safer than the national average.

Where is Clark County in GA?
Clarke County is located in the northeastern part of the U.S. state of Georgia. As of the 2010 census, the population was 116,714. Its county seat is Athens, with which it is a consolidated city-county….Clarke County, Georgia.

What is the population of Oconee County GA?
Oconee County is located in Georgia with a population of 35,071. Oconee County is one of the best places to live in Georgia. Living in Oconee County offers residents a rural feel and most residents own their homes. Many families live in Oconee County and residents tend to be conservative. The public schools in Oconee County are highly rated.
Where is the Oconee River in Georgia located?
The entirety of Oconee County is located in the Upper Oconee River sub-basin of the Altamaha River basin. Adjacent counties. Clarke County (north) Oglethorpe County (east) Greene County (southeast) Morgan County (south) Walton County (west) Barrow County (northwest) National protected area.
